Understanding Mobile Billboard Trucks
Advertising with mobile billboards involves placing eye-catching visuals on the sides of trucks or other vehicles. These mobile units then drive through high-traffic areas, exposing the message to thousands of potential customers every day.

What Does Truck Advertising Cost?
Pricing for mobile truck advertising varies depending on duration, format, and market.
- Standard mobile billboard (vinyl wrap): $1,000–$3,000 per week
- Digital LED truck: $2,500–$7,000+ per week
- Custom experiential truck: pricing on request
